The hexadecimal color code #14446B corresponds to the code RGB( 20, 68, 107 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,08 level), green (at 0,27 level) and blue (at 0,42 level). Its brightness is 24% and its saturation is 68%. It is composed of red at 10%, green at 34% and blue at 54%.
